Bayesiansk ego-netværksanalyse

Bayesiansk ego-netværksanalyse anvender probabilistisk inferens på ego-centrerede (personlige) netværksdata, idet en likelihood-model for ego'ets lokale netværk kombineres med prior-fordelinger over netværksparametre. Resultatet er en fuld posterior-fordeling, der kvantificerer usikkerhed om strukturelle træk som alter-sammensætning, tie-tæthed og netværksstørrelse – snarere end udelukkende at producere punkt-estimater.
